After that 'GAU' yesterday I also looked for more information and alternatives. - OgreODE is was last maintained on the 12th of january but not further developed. That explains why the last existing release was based on ogre 1.2.x Dagon and not on 1.4.x Eihort. Interesting that compiling on nico's l...
